James J. Maher

James J. Maher, C.M. (born inMaywood,New Jersey), is an AmericanCatholic priest and academic administrator. He isNiagara University's 26th president since being named such on August 1, 2013.[1] He succeededJoseph L. Levesque.

Education

edit

In 1984, Maher received aBachelor of Arts inSociology fromSt. John's University. In 1989 he obtained aMaster of Divinity and in 1990 aMaster of Theology fromMary Immaculate Seminary, followed by aDoctor of Ministry (D.Min.) from theImmaculate Conception Seminary School of Theology in 2004.[2]

Career

edit

Maher pronounced his vows to the Vincentian community in May 1989 and was ordained to the priesthood on May 26, 1990.

Since then, he has been Campus Minister (1994–1999), Vice President for University Ministry (1999-2005), Vice President for Student Affairs (2004-2010), executive director of the Vincentian Institute for Social Action (2009-2010) and Executive Vice President for Mission and Student Services (2011-2013) atSt. John's University.
